Retinitis Pigmentosa Antibodies

Santa Cruz Biotechnology provides a broad selection of Retinitis Pigmentosa monoclonal antibodies for advanced research into this degenerative eye disease. Retinitis Pigmentosa Antibodies are compatible with multiple techniques, including western blotting (WB), immunoprecipitation (IP), immunofluorescence (IF), immunohistochemistry with paraffin-embedded sections (IHCP), flow cytometry (FCM), and enzyme-linked immunosorbent assay (ELISA). Retinitis Pigmentosa is a group of inherited disorders that lead to progressive degeneration of the retina, resulting in vision loss. Molecules targeted by Retinitis Pigmentosa monoclonal antibodies play crucial roles in phototransduction and retinal cell survival, enabling deeper understanding of the underlying disease mechanisms.
